Mexican investigators suspect organized crime involvement in the assassination of Ernesto Vásquez Reyna, a federal official in Tamaulipas, likely as retaliation for recent fuel seizures. The attack occurred in Reynosa, a city known for cartel violence, where Vásquez Reyna was killed by gunmen, with authorities linking the incident to a faction of the Gulf Cartel amid ongoing conflicts over drug trafficking and fuel theft.
